Passer au contenu principal

CSS




Concepto de CSS

¿Qué es el CSS?

CSS es un lenguaje de programación que se usa para definir el estilo y el aspecto de un documento que se ha escrito mediante de un lenguaje de etiquetas, como HTML. Conocido además como hojas de estilo en cascada, es el que se emplea para dar colores, indicar tipos de letra o inclusive resaltar aspectos como el espacio entre items para dotar de estilo a una web.

Es uno de los pilares fundamentales del desarrollo y el diseño web, como además una de las mayores pesadillas de todo programador. Puesto que es el conjunto de reglas que se indican a los navegadores para que muestren los items de una página, realizar las instrucciones incorrectas puede desembocar en la presentación de una web imposible de visualizar correctamente.

Generalmente, cada una de las reglas CSS que se emplean están compuestas por una serie de propiedades, o properties, que poseen valores con los que se indica la presentación de todo el contenido dictado en HTML; y, a parte de esto, selectores con los que se indican qué items se verán afectados por dichas propiedades y sus valores.

Todo este conjunto es el que conforma los archivos que se han de indicar a los navegadores para establecer la apariencia de las páginas web. A pesar de todo, lo complicado de su manejo y la necesidad de aprender nociones de programación son algo que suele llevar a muchos a confiar en plantillas predeterminadas u otras soluciones mucho más cómodas que hacen estas tareas infinitamente más simples, aún cuando renunciando a la total personalización.

Para qué sirve el CSS

CSS sirve para poder dar un estilo a cualquier web y hacerlo con las reglas que se deseen. Es el lenguaje con el que el programador y el navegador se comunican para indicar a este último cómo ha de distribuir los contenidos de una web en base a las instrucciones indicadas en los correspondientes ficheros.

A su vez, tiene como principal finalidad obtener estilos distintos y a medida de las necesidades de cada página. Aún cuando, desafortunadamente, exige un amplio conocimiento de programación y grandes nociones de lenguaje HTML además para obtener la conexión perfecta entre estilo y contenidos.

Ejemplos de CSS

Para dar un ejemplo de CSS, vamos a proceder con unas sencillas líneas de código para web y para la hoja de estilo.

Primero, vamos con la web:

<!DOCTYPE html>

<meta charset=”utf-8″>

<title>CSS Ejemplo de NeoAttack</title>

<enlace rel=”stylesheet” href=”style.css”>

<h1>Agencia de marketing digital</h1>

Ahora, seguimos indicando que el texto dentro del título H1 tendrá color rojo y un fondo azul utilizando CSS:h1
{

background-color: blue;

color: red;

}

Combinando ambos, el primer conjunto llama al archivo style.css para hacer que el H1 luzca como hemos indicado.

Más información sobre el CSS

Para aprender más sobre CSS, te sugerimos que leas los artículos que enlazamos a continuación, contienen más información al respecto.

R Marketing Numérique